BitmoLab, the tech brand formed by JSAUX and SSPAI, a group of Chinese tech media, announces the release of a new version of the GAMEBABY, the case that turns the iPhone 15 & 16 Pro Max into a retro console thanks to its physical interface, that mimics those of the 16-bit controllers. This new GAMEBABY has been designed with metal and silicone materials (versus the mix of plastic and silicone of the previous one) and sports a fresher look. Early bird customers can get a unit for $24.99 and shipments are expected to start in mid-to-late March.

ABOUT THE GAMEBABY
The GAMEBABY is an iPhone 15 Pro Max & iPhone 16 Pro Max case with an added feature. In addition to providing protection for your phone, the lower part of the case also serves as a game controller. You can detach it from the back of your phone and place it on the front in order to play retro games* with a physical interface similar to those of the controllers of 16-bit consoles from the early 90s. After finishing your game, the GameBaby returns to its original shape, protecting your iPhone and allowing you to enjoy its full screen.
